Senior Geo-Environmental Engineer – Southampton, UK

Full-time, permanent position within RSK Geosciences, part of the RSK Group.

Responsibilities

  • Designing and managing a variety of geo-environmental and geotechnical ground investigation and interpretative projects for both external clients and for other teams within RSK.
  • Soil and rock logging to current geotechnical standards, including laboratory scheduling.
  • Prepare H&S plans and RAMS.
  • Preparation of Remediation Strategy’s including verification works on site.
  • Establish and develop strong working relationships with new and existing clients, which is integral to the growth of the Geosciences department and the wider business.
  • Provide technical leadership in the day to day delivery of projects.

Qualifications and Experience

  • BEng or BSc or equivalent in Civil, Geology or Geotechnical Engineering or similar.
  • Typically a further degree in Engineering Geology, Geotechnics or Environmental Science or equivalent would be desirable.
  • Registered with a suitable professional body and have Chartered status with a relevant institution (e.g. Geol Soc/CIWEM/ICE).
  • Significant and demonstrable experience of Geotechnical and Geoenvironmental investigations and reporting.
  • Demonstrable experience and ability to prepare Geotechnical and Geo-environmental Preliminary.
  • Full UK Driving Licence.
